What To Make a Marriage is like to read

A category-romance premise built on a hidden pregnancy and an unavoidable family friend — emotional stakes are interpersonal and domestic, with the tension coming from secrets that can't stay secret much longer. Best for: readers who want a short, tropey Harlequin-style secret-baby romance with a clear emotional arc.

About To Make a Marriage — what the genome says

Does To Make a Marriage have a happy ending?

Yes — the genome marks the romance arc as a guaranteed happily-ever-after (HEA).

Is To Make a Marriage a complete story or a cliffhanger?

It's a complete, standalone-satisfying story.

How spicy is To Make a Marriage?

Low heat — mostly fade-to-black.

Who is To Make a Marriage for?

readers who want a short, tropey Harlequin-style secret-baby romance with a clear emotional arc
